Barça Set to Play First Fixture at Partially Completed Camp Nou on Saturday

Barcelona have announced their first game will take place at the partially upgraded Camp Nou this Saturday. They will welcome the Basque side in domestic competition two and a half years since relocating so building work could begin.

“We envisioned this comeback. The moment has arrived. Home again at Spotify Camp Nou.”

Not all seats will be available though over 45,000 attendees can be present based on approved permits. When completed, the Camp Nou is due to hold close to 105,000 fans, up from the previous 99,000. Officials confirmed recent additions comprise an updated entryway for the team along with upgraded changing facilities.

Recent Activities

The club conducted a fan-accessible workout inside the stadium earlier this month. They mentioned they were hoping for permission by UEFA to host the next European match versus the German side on 9 December at Camp Nou. Their recent games have been held at the Olympic Stadium.
